The Purpose of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ds serve as an important financial security mechanism for executors and managers managing the distribution of an estate. As an administrator or administrator, you have the responsibility to take care of the assets and financial debts of the departed person's estate. The probate bond, likewise referred to as an executor bond or fiduciary bond, makes sure that you accomplish your obligations fairly and lawfully.

By needing a probate bond, the court aims to guard the estate from any type of possible mismanagement or misbehavior on your part. If you, as the executor or manager,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ond offers a form of insurance coverage to make up the recipients of the estate for any kind of monetary losses sustained. This defense is important in cases where the executor makes errors in dealing with the estate's assets or stops working to comply with the lawful needs of the probate procedure.

Eventually, probate bonds supply satisfaction to the recipients of the estate, as they provide a layer of monetary safety and security against the threats related to estate management.
